NNPC owes gasoline suppliers $6bn
Nigeria’s state-owned oil company, Nigeria National Petroleum Company, NNPC, owes gasoline suppliers between $3 billion and $6 billion for previous imports, trade sources told Reuters, although the company said it was meeting its obligations.
Edo needs N100bn to tackle erosion—Commissioner
EDO State Government has said that it will cost it over N100billion to address the problems of erosion and flooding in Benin City.
